In Head Coach Rick Pitino's seventh year at Kentucky he won the National Championship. This is his seventh year at Louisville and we won't count him out. Last years 24-10 team loses only one player in two guard Brandon Jenkins and returns a deep, athletic, talented group ready to challenge Georgetown for Big East supremacy.There are so many good players on the roster that talent and depth aren't a concern; only playing time and health. Pitino has hired former player Walter McCarty to help with the big men and help instill in them the importance of team concept .
Let's start in the frontcourt where the only two seniors reside. David Padget is an oft injured 6'11" powerful force at center. Juan Palacios is a 6'8" forward who has battled through ankle problems since his freshman year. If healthy these two players could carry any team a long way. Terence Williams will be the third starter up front at 6'8". He is the team's most talented player. Not only can he rebound and explode to the basket but on nights when he's called upon to play the point he executes that admirably. Throw in Derrick Caracter, a powerful 6'8" 265lb talent and Eric Clark a 6'8" jumping jack who is a matchup nightmare, and you have a great frontcourt.
The backcourt may not be as deep but it is just as talented. Edgar Sosa is a point/scorer. He had 31 points in the season ending loss to Texas A&M. Sophomore Jerry Smith will be the other guard. He's the long range marksman with a 48% three point shooting touch. Andre McGee who was hurt most of last year will provide depth at the guard position.
Caracter, Sosa, Jerry Smith, and Earl Clark are all sophomores so the future looks bright in Louisville, this is one of Pitino's best teams and who better than him to take all this talent on a ride deep into the NCAA tournament?
